14:22 — Keyturn rotation utility invoked against production vault by the scheduled job. Rotation succeeded for database creds but the cache layer kept serving stale tokens for nine minutes, causing auth failures in the Fennig API. Mitigated by forcing a cache flush. Note for new folks: always check cache TTLs after rotation. The job's build token appears below.

session token of tajef-bageg = htk21_5d90d574934f3ccae6437

## Test Plan: Stathound Sidecar — Weekly Sync Notes

Coverage for the metrics-aggregation sidecar includes flush-interval edge cases, counter overflow at the 32-bit boundary, and label cardinality caps. We will replay two hours of production-shaped traffic against a staging pod and compare aggregated output to the reference summarizer. Discrepancies above 0.5% fail the run. The replay client must authenticate against the staging collector, so runs should include the token shown below.

portal login ticket: eyJhbGciOiJIUzI1NiIsInR5cCI6IkpXVCJ9.eyJzdWIiOiIwEOsktwVNwIn0.-UJU3fdyyCgG

Finance Review — Varnholt Joint Venture Proposal

Reviewed the Varnholt JV terms. Capital commitment: staged over three years. Projected payback: year four, assuming Kestrel line volumes hold. Risks: currency exposure and governance split at 50/50 with no casting vote. Recommendation: proceed to due diligence, cap initial outlay. Do not circulate beyond this team. The strategic rationale is summarised confidentially below.

internal memo for fajog-yagaf: Gross margin on Ulaael came in at 20 percent against a plan of 10 percent. Only 9 of the 80 pilot accounts renewed Ulaael, so a churn review is set for July 1.